User Switching est une extension légère mais efficace pour WordPress. Elle permet de changer instantanément de compte utilisateur sans se déconnecter.
Longtemps incluse par défaut dans WPDistrib, elle est désormais optionnelle, mais reste un outil pertinent selon certains cas d’usage spécifiques.
Comprendre l’intérêt de changer d’utilisateur sans déconnexion
Changer d’utilisateur sans se déconnecter manuellement est un gain de temps précieux pour les administrateurs WordPress.
👉 Fluidifier la gestion multi-comptes, notamment dans les projets avec plusieurs rôles actifs.
👉 Éviter la répétition des connexions pour vérifier les différentes interfaces utilisateurs.
👉 Maintenir une session administrateur active, tout en pouvant simuler rapidement l’expérience d’autres comptes.
Ce processus permet une gestion simplifiée sans rupture du flux de travail.
Simplifier les tests de rôles utilisateur
Grâce à User Switching, les tests de rôles sont accélérés :
👉 Passer instantanément d’un compte administrateur à un rôle de rédacteur ou d’abonné pour vérifier que chaque utilisateur dispose des accès adaptés.
👉 Contrôler les menus et les fonctionnalités disponibles selon le rôle testé.
👉 Simuler des situations réelles d’utilisation pour s’assurer que l’expérience utilisateur reste cohérente.
L’extension devient ainsi un atout pour valider la configuration des permissions avant mise en production.
Gagner du temps sur la vérification des accès
Les administrateurs bénéficient d’un vrai gain d’efficacité grâce à la bascule en un clic.
✅ Éviter l’utilisation de la navigation privée ou de multiples navigateurs.
✅ Revenir rapidement au compte d’origine après chaque vérification.
✅ Réaliser des contrôles en série sur plusieurs profils sans interrompre la session principale.
Cela simplifie les tâches récurrentes de contrôle des accès et permissions.
Améliorer l’expérience utilisateur pour les débutants
User Switching se révèle également précieuse pour accompagner les profils débutants ou non techniques dans l’écosystème WordPress.
💡 Créer des rôles intermédiaires (ex : éditeur personnalisé ou auteur) pour limiter l’accès aux fonctionnalités critiques de l’administration WordPress.
💡 Basculer en un clic d’un compte administrateur vers un compte éditeur ou auteur, offrant ainsi une interface allégée et moins complexe pour les rédacteurs ou contributeurs.
💡 Réduire considérablement les risques d’erreurs sur les sites de production, notamment pour les utilisateurs qui se concentrent uniquement sur la création d’articles ou de pages.
Cette extension s’associe particulièrement bien avec une extension comme Members, qui permet de créer ces rôles intermédiaires sur-mesure. Par exemple, un rôle d’éditeur avancé pourrait donner la possibilité de modifier des thèmes ou des paramètres liés à l’apparence, sans toutefois disposer de l’intégralité des droits administrateur.
En pratique, cela permet à un utilisateur débutant de passer du rôle administrateur à un rôle restreint en quelques secondes, pour travailler dans une interface plus sécurisée, mieux adaptée à ses besoins immédiats.
Identifier les cas où User Switching devient un atout
🚀 Phase de tests : pour vérifier les interfaces selon les rôles utilisateurs.
🚀 Déploiement client : pour simuler les droits d’un client final ou d’un contributeur.
🚀 Formation WordPress : pour illustrer en temps réel les différences entre les rôles lors d’ateliers pédagogiques.
🚀 Projets collaboratifs : pour alterner entre les comptes et valider la cohérence des accès au sein d’une équipe.
🌀 User Switching n’est plus inclus dans WPDistrib, mais reste une extension optionnelle recommandée
User Switching n’est plus installée de base dans la distribution WPDistrib, mais reste une solution optionnelle à envisager selon les besoins.
Pour les projets nécessitant une gestion fine des rôles ou pour les équipes qui souhaitent sécuriser l’expérience de leurs contributeurs, User Switching demeure une extension efficace pour optimiser la gestion multi-comptes et simplifier l’expérience WordPress des utilisateurs moins techniques.

